51 lines
1.3 KiB
Plaintext
51 lines
1.3 KiB
Plaintext
|
|
rsync -avz -e root@10.100.2.121:/root/.ssh/* /root/.ssh/
|
|
|
|
scp root@10.100.2.121:/root/.ssh/* /root/.ssh/
|
|
|
|
# 删除空白行
|
|
sed -i '/^$/d' /root/.ssh/*
|
|
|
|
ssh 10.100.2.121
|
|
|
|
docker 安装
|
|
mkdir -p /etc/docker
|
|
rsync -av --ignore-existing root@10.100.2.121:/usr/lib/systemd/system /usr/lib/systemd/system
|
|
rsync -av --ignore-existing root@10.100.2.121:/usr/local/bin /usr/local/bin
|
|
rsync -av --ignore-existing root@10.100.2.121:/etc/docker /etc/docker
|
|
rsync -av --ignore-existing root@10.100.2.121:/usr/bin /usr/bin
|
|
groupadd docker
|
|
|
|
# debug
|
|
journalctl -u containerd -n 100 -f
|
|
|
|
journalctl -u docker -n 100 -f
|
|
journalctl -u docker.socket -n 100 -f
|
|
|
|
systemctl stop docker.socket
|
|
|
|
systemctl start containerd
|
|
systemctl start docker.socket
|
|
systemctl start docker
|
|
|
|
sed -i "s/10.100.2.121/192.168.211.215/g" /etc/docker/daemon.json
|
|
systemctl restart docker
|
|
|
|
集群启动
|
|
|
|
镜像同步
|
|
haorbor数据完全同步
|
|
|
|
|
|
mkdir -p /root/wdd
|
|
mkdir -p /var/lib/docker/harbor-data
|
|
rsync -avz -e root@10.100.2.121:/root/wdd /root/wdd
|
|
scp -r root@10.100.2.121:/root/wdd/* /root/wdd/
|
|
rsync -avz -e root@10.100.2.121:/var/lib/docker/harbor-data/ /var/lib/docker/harbor-data/
|
|
scp -R root@10.100.2.121:/var/lib/docker/harbor-data/ /var/lib/docker/harbor-data/
|
|
|
|
|
|
yaml文件同步
|
|
备份下来 然后同步
|
|
|